Former garden centre site is up for sale

An opportunity to acquire a commercial development site on the outskirts of Harrogate has gone on the market.

The former Cascades Garden Centre, on the A61 at Bishop Monkton between Harrogate and Ripon, closed earlier this year after the owner’s decision to relocate.

Lambert Smith Hampton (LSH) is selling the two-acre site which includes existing buildings extending to 18,363 sq ft, on behalf of a private client.

Offers in the region of £850,000 are invited for the freehold property, which is sold with vacant possession.

As well as once being home to the largest suppliers of aquarium-related equipment and fish stock in the North of England, the property has also been operated as a wedding venue, specialist food emporium and children’s party room.

Richard Corby, director at LSH’s Leeds office and a life-long Harrogate resident, said: “This is a rare opportunity for a local business to acquire a site for its own use, or for a developer to create a business park offering a range of accommodation for commercial occupiers.”
